Up for grabs today is a copy of 1, 2, 3 Sew: Build Your Skills with 33 Simple Sewing Projectsby Ellen Luckett Baker. I have been a long time fan of Ellen’s blog The Long Thread so it only makes sense that I would enjoy her book.


The title says it all with Bags, Accessories, Home Accents and More. There are step by step instructions on how to make everything from a coaster for your cocktail to a burp cloth for your baby. Plus everything in-between. The projects are divided by themed chapters like Organizers, Pillows and even Blockhead Animals.


1-2-3 Sew is not your run of the mill sewing book. Sure you will be using your sewing machine for these projects, but you are also inspired to use fruit as a stamp, bust out the embroidery hoop and even make some quilting yo-yo’s.


There are 33 projects in all that build on each other. Say you start with the simple glasses case that even I could make. From there you build on what you just learned to make a zippered pouch. Once you have mastered those two projects you are ready to graduate to the cosmetic bag which incorporates skills you learned making the previous projects. 1-2-3 Sew – get it?


There are easy to follow instructions, 12 patterns, gorgeous pictures and helpful how-to illustrations inside. A gem of a sewing guide for intermediate and beginner seamsters.
